The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. Coney Island Preparatory Public Charter School is a charter school for students in grades K-12 located at 315 Avenue U Ave in Brooklyn, NY. The school has a total enrollment of 1,162 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 13:1. Academic records show that 32%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 43% are proficient in reading. Coney Island Preparatory Public Charter School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of B and a GreatSchools Rating of 6 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.16, the graduation rate is 82%, and the average SAT score is 1070. The average home value in this area is $655,765.
